The Legal Process

The most common reason families file an Erb's palsy lawsuit is to seek compensation for 72.caiwik.com medical expenses and other losses. The amount of money awarded in a settlement is dependent on the particular situation of your child as well as the severity of their injuries, but can easily soar into the millions of dollars.

Many Erb's palsy lawsuits are resolved outside of court. Lawyers for the plaintiff and defendant collaborate to negotiate an agreement that is satisfactory to both parties. This can drastically cut down on the legal process and avoid your family from having to appear before jurors or judges. If your family members are unable to come to a deal the family will have to appear in the court. This can take a considerable amount of time, but can also result in a larger settlement.

The brachial nerves control the movement of the arm. During labor and birth excessive forceful pulling on the head, neck or shoulders or on arms, erb's palsy law firms could result in damage to these nerves and cause Erb's palsy. In many cases, this injury can be prevented. Families file a lawsuit to hold negligent healthcare professionals accountable for the injuries that they cause. They also want to spread awareness about this birth injury which could have been prevented. In the past, these lawsuits have helped families obtain a fair financial settlement and help their child get back on course.

Complaints in Court

Many children with Erb's -Pallsy can overcome physical limitations with intensive daily physical therapy. Some children require surgery to repair torn nerve fibers. A significant number of children will never recover and have to live their lives with the consequences of this birth injury. Parents who believe their child's Erb's syndrome was due to medical negligence during the delivery process have the right to seek an appropriate amount of compensation for the injuries suffered by their child.

To establish the value of your case, your lawyer will work with doctors who specialize in treating these ailments to develop a lifetime cost-of-living estimate. This will allow you to determine the amount of compensation you are entitled to through your Erb's settlement for palsy. Your lawyer can also assist you obtain copies of your child's medical records and investigate whether the doctor who performed your child's birth had a history of similar malpractice cases.

Once your lawyer has a thorough knowledge of the injuries suffered by your child then she will file your lawsuit against the defendants. Both parties will go through the discovery process that involves exchanging evidence like expert opinions, depositions, additional medical records, and more. This is an essential part of your legal case because it allows you to build your arguments. Settlements can last up to one year.

Settlement

When your erb's palsy attorney palsy lawsuit is successful, your lawyer may be able to secure compensation for medical costs and future treatment costs, including adaptive devices and physical therapy. You could also be awarded damages for emotional trauma and loss of quality of life.

Your lawyer must gather evidence to prove mistake that led to your child's brachial-plexus injury which could include medical documents, witness statements, and expert testimony. After your lawyer has gathered this evidence, they will file the lawsuit against the defendants, who are typically the medical professionals who delivered your child. The defendants are given a set period of time to respond to the lawsuit, and during the discovery phase both sides will gather more evidence to support their assertions.

Most lawsuits are settled outside of court rather than going to trial, because it's cost-effective for all parties involved. If your lawyer is confident that they will prevail in court, they could choose to take the case to a verdict by a jury. A successful verdict in a birth injury lawsuit can provide families with a sense justice, and also help to raise awareness to prevent these types of injuries from happening in the future. However, if the verdict is not favorable to you, you can appeal the decision. Although this process may take more time, it can also increase the amount of compensation you receive.
